Show Legion to give reminders CEDAR CITY - On May 22 the red crepe-paper crepe-paper poppy will be of- fered to the residents of Iron County by the American Legion Auxiliary. This reminder of the sacrifice of countless thousands in four wars is an annual event undertaken un-dertaken by the members of the Auxiliary. Volunteers will once again take part in this nation-wide program in memory of the citizens soldiers who gave their lives in the cause of freedom. Funds collected on Poppy Day are used to assist the needy veteran and his family. It is a self-help self-help program, for the Auxiliary's familiar red paper poppy is handmade hand-made in poppy shops run by Auxiliary volunteers. In these shops, disabled and hospitalized veterans make the flowers by hand, petal by petal. It is part of a physical and psychological therapy program by veterans for veterans. These poppies are purchased from the shop by the Auxiliary and offered to the public, not at a price, but for a contribution. This memorial flower was adopted by the America n Legion Auxiliary in 1920, and since that time programs have been conducted throughout the United States each year. |
